Finn’s is an independent rural based chartered surveying and property practice with a long history and currently comprises three offices in East Kent. Finn’s serves a wide range of agricultural, commercial, development and residential clients. The firm’s busy and wide-ranging workload, most of which is within Kent, includes valuations, planning, landlord/tenant, compulsory purchase claims, BPS, farm and land sales, management of various landed estates, renewable energy and residential and commercial development. The firm has separate residential sales and lettings departments.

The firm prides itself on its traditional values with a modern approach providing our clients with an unrivaled service. At the heart of this are the people working within Finn’s.

We have a fantastic opportunity for an administration assistant to primarily provide support for the continued growth and success of the residential lettings department. The role will provide the right candidate with a varied and interesting workload.

Principal duties and responsibilities;
• Handling telephone, online and in-office enquiries
• Dealing with general correspondence.
• Using Property Management software in order to produce documentation to enable the letting and ongoing management of a significant
number of properties, i.e. preparation of tenancy agreements and associated documentation.
• Ensuring legal requirements relating to residential lettings are adhered to. e.g. landlord’s gas safety inspections.
• Preparing and typing inventories.
• Additionally, there may be the need to assist other members of the Lettings team by attending viewings, carrying out property inspections
and compiling inventories.

Requirements;
• A self-motivated person is required who can work closely within a small team to ensure our professional standards are maintained.
• Comprehensive working knowledge of Microsoft applications, including Word, Excel and Outlook. Knowledge of dedicated Residential
Lettings software would be an advantage
• Attention to detail and the ability to work under pressure is essential.
• The ability to communicate effectively with clients, tenants, contractors, in a friendly and professional manner is vital.
• A flexible attitude to work responsibilities is required
• A driving licence is essential
• Working hours include alternate Saturday mornings – with a half day off in lieu during the week
